Transaction 5cf62c295c2e2cb6b93b9207e97c764f5bbda3d93ff2c85ca20e3377988ed3ea
1 Input
1 Output
-
5cf62c295c2e2cb6b93b9207e97c764f5bbda3d93ff2c85ca20e3377988ed3ea:0
- value
- 680798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e4fd59d67e336dcac61365efd8723a611830215 OP_EQUAL
- address
- 3DCthi277zHMesU78QNxrYeF9r8NvCT5W8